These salami-stuffed chicken drumsticks are perfect picnic fare – easy to make a day ahead then throw in the car with a bottle of red, a couple of glasses and some serviettes and head out to some pretty spot that feels a million miles away from daily life. One of my favourites is the historic village of St Albans north-west of Sydney, with its early settlers’ cemetery, car ferry river crossing and wetland common, it makes for a perfect day trip. Use one hand to dip the chicken in the egg and the other for the breadcrumbs to avoid crumbing your fingers too much; and use packet breadcrumbs if you prefer. Make some green beans with garlic & mint dressing to take along (see video below, they’re great at room temperature and can be made the day before too) and as for that bottle of red, try the Beaujolais-style Sorrenberg Gamay from Beechworth in Victoria – one of my favourite Aussie reds.
